Output 41c7d89340142a2ae7992be726ad04aa8ec1703bb94a724a19806be2023ceed4:1

value
28514890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13faf2f75b5618f0e0f1c6d1a06611204f8f478b OP_EQUAL
address
33WfPSHXmtYBg8iETjaq8hScmd4aaPXnRG
transaction
41c7d89340142a2ae7992be726ad04aa8ec1703bb94a724a19806be2023ceed4
spent
true